Output 19f312835206e659bcba1f12c685b31d814bce7c206705cac1326a6fd5fbb756:54

value
109180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a951b2727a5deb561b26b90f0a0d18d3e3c4175d OP_EQUAL
address
3H8HzNfMtL2b8VTHced6pYFyr1HmcekTp5
transaction
19f312835206e659bcba1f12c685b31d814bce7c206705cac1326a6fd5fbb756
spent
true